About Solomon Snyder's research
Solomon Snyder is a researcher at Johns Hopkins University School of Medicine. Their work has been cited 297,372 times across 1,000 publications (h-index 337), according to Google Scholar.
Their most-cited work, “Isolation of nitric oxide synthetase, a calmodulin-requiring enzyme.” (1990), has accumulated 3,303 citations.
